The Great Pennsylvania Charter School Round Up
Here's the skinny: according to the 2022-23 school year, Pennsylvania boasts a whopping 165 brick-and-mortar charter schools and a cool 14 cyber charter schools. That's a lot of schools! How To FAQs:
- How to Apply to a Charter School in Pennsylvania? Each school has its own application process, so check out their website. But be warned, some popular ones can be competitive!
- How to Choose a Charter School? Consider your child's needs and interests, school size and location, and of course, that all-important llama mascot situation.
- How Much Do Charter Schools Cost? Public charter schools are free to attend, but some may have fees for extracurricular activities.
- How Are Charter Schools Funded? They get public funding, but not as much as traditional public schools.
- How Do I Know If a Charter School is Right for My Child? Research, research, research! Talk to other parents, visit the schools, and make sure it vibes with your educational philosophy (and your kid's personality, of course).
